What is the cheapest month to fly from Savannah to Rochester?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Savannah to Rochester,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Savannah to Rochester is June, where tickets cost $206 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and March,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$586 and $465 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Savannah to Rochester?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Rochester with an airline and back to Savannah with another airline. Booking your flights between Savannah and ROC can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
